Access and Beyond
Unit C1, 35 Intersite Avenue, Umgeni Business Park, Durban
Core business offering: Access and Beyond is a dominant force in the electronic security distribution market for over two decades. It strives to provide innovative, tailored solutions that meet each client’s unique requirements. Its team carries skilled product experts and support staff dedicated to providing clients with complete guidance and support in selecting suitable solutions. Regardless of the scale and complexity of your project, Access and Beyond will help you find the right solution.
